The Rise of AI in Lighting Control

Artificial intelligence is no longer a futuristic concept in stage lighting; it’s rapidly becoming the norm. 2024 sees sophisticated AI-powered systems capable of automating complex lighting cues, learning from past performances to optimize future shows, and even predicting potential issues before they arise. This allows lighting designers to focus on the creative aspects of their work, leaving the technical minutiae to intelligent algorithms. We explore the leading AI-driven lighting consoles and software, highlighting their capabilities and analyzing their impact on the industry’s workflow and efficiency. This includes a look at how AI facilitates personalized audience experiences by adapting lighting schemes in real-time based on audience reactions or even individual preferences (where feasible).

Miniaturization and Wireless Technology: A New Era of Flexibility

The quest for smaller, more versatile fixtures continues. 2024 showcases a significant leap forward in miniaturization, with incredibly compact LED fixtures offering surprisingly powerful output. Combined with the increasing reliability and range of wireless DMX technology, this allows for greater design freedom and unprecedented flexibility. We delve into the specifics of these advancements, looking at the energy efficiency benefits, the implications for rigging and setup times, and the expanded possibilities for creative lighting designs in challenging spaces.

Sustainable Stage Lighting: Eco-Conscious Choices for the Modern Theatre

Environmental concerns are driving innovation in stage lighting. The industry is embracing energy-efficient LED technology at an unprecedented rate, and 2024 witnesses a surge in fixtures designed with sustainability in mind. This includes a focus on recyclable materials, reduced energy consumption, and extended lifespan. We analyze the leading eco-friendly options available, assessing their performance and cost-effectiveness, and discussing the long-term environmental impact of choosing sustainable stage lighting solutions. We’ll also discuss the growing trend of using solar-powered lighting options for outdoor performances.
